- Page 2 of the RMA form is the financial worksheet-every homeowner is required to complete this as part of the application process when they are requesting a loan modification.
- There are 3 major pieces of information that you must provide: monthly gross household income, monthly household expenses and your assets. Together, all of this information provides the bank with a snapshot of your current financial situation. They use all of these figures in a standard approval formula to determine if you fit the program guidelines or not.
